Coded Crafters

Our Software Development Process

Requirement Analysis

This initial phase involves gathering and analyzing the needs and requirements of the end-users to ensure the software solution accurately addresses and solves their problems or fulfills their needs.

Design

Our design process involves selecting the right architecture, patterns, and protocols to ensure scalability, performance, and security.

Implementation (Coding)

Our development teams engage in writing clean, efficient, and scalable code based on the predefined design specifications.

Testing

In the testing phase, our dedicated Quality Assurance teams meticulously scrutinize the software to detect and rectify any issues, bugs, or deviations from the original specifications.

Deployment

Our team works diligently to monitor the deployment process, addressing any deployment issues promptly, and ensuring the software is optimally configured in the live environment.

Maintenance and Support

This phase involves regular updates, performance optimization, security enhancements, and adding new features as needed.